Official abstract text for this publication.
A seal and a seal assembly. The seal includes a generally annular casing, an engaging feature coupled to or integral with the casing and configured to be coupled to an accessory that is separate from the casing, and a generally annular sealing element coupled to the casing, the engaging feature, or both. The sealing element is configured to seal with a relatively movable member, wherein the engaging feature is separately-formed from the sealing element.

What is claimed is: 1. A seal, comprising: a connector insert having a first wall portion and a second wall portion; a generally annular casing including an axial cylinder and a flange projecting radially inward from a first end of the cylinder, the flange contacting the first wall portion of the connector insert at a first joint; and a generally annular sealing element contacting the second wall portion of the connector insert at a second joint, the sealing element being configured to seal with a relatively movable member, wherein the connector insert is separately formed from the sealing element and separately formed from the casing, and wherein a first portion of the connector insert lies axially inside the cylinder and a second portion of the connector insert lies axially outside the cylinder. 2. The seal of claim 1 , wherein the second portion extends into a pocket in the sealing element. 3. The seal of claim 1 , wherein the first wall portion is substantially perpendicular to the second wall portion or is substantially parallel to and not coplanar with the second wall portion. 4. The seal of claim 3 , wherein the connector insert includes a radially outwardly facing channel, wherein the first wall portion comprises a first side of the channel and wherein the second wall portion is located outside the channel. 5. The seal of claim 4 , wherein a sub-channel is defined by a second side of the channel and the flange, the sub-channel being configured to receive a portion of an accessory. 6.
